Early Availability Programs
Early availability programs for upcoming Harmony SASE enhancements:
- Agent 11.5 – Enhanced Security, Control, and Usability
The latest Agent 11.5 update introduces multiple improvements to security, policy enforcement, and user experience.
What's New:- New Threat Prevention Policy – Includes threat emulation, anti-bot, and malware protection, with the flexibility to enable or disable as needed.
- Trusted Networks via HTTPS Server – Define trusted networks based on an HTTPS server, enhancing security posture.
- URL Filtering Log Support – Enables logging for better visibility and analysis of URL filtering actions (Allow or Deny).
- Application Control Enhancements – Administrators can now regulate the use of SaaS applications, ensuring compliance and security by allowing, blocking, or restricting specific applications based on policies. This helps prevent unauthorized access, control bandwidth usage, and enforce corporate security guidelines.
- Transparent Internet Access Installation – This is a simplified deployment with seamless internet access configuration. For more information, see MDM App Deployment.
- Enhanced Anti-Tampering Protection – Agent exit code protection now also applies to uninstallation, preventing unauthorized removal.
- These updates enhance security, visibility, and ease of management for administrators.

- Next-Generation Networking (NGN) – Advancing network performance and security for modern enterprise needs.
Admins can now gain early access to NGN capabilities and provide feedback before the general release. To participate, contact your Check Point representative.What's New:
- Single Public IP per Region – Simplifies management by eliminating the need to handle individual gateway IPs.
- Enhanced IPSec Tunnels – Supports up to eight parallel tunnel legs for improved redundancy, link aggregation, and streamlined IPSec configuration.
New Features
- New Point-of-Presence (PoP) in Zurich, Switzerland, expanding coverage and enhancing performance.
- Harmony SASE now features a redesigned log screen that matches the look and feel of Check Point’s Infinity Events. This update provides a seamless and consistent experience across platforms, enhancing visibility and simplifying log analysis.
